Linguists Carmen Fought and Karen Eisenhauer are in the process of analyzing every line of dialogue in Disney's 12 animated princess movies from 1937 to 2013. Their project is still ongoing, but they gave a preview of their data during a linguistics conference reported by the Washington Post. While female characters speak 50% to 70% of the lines in the vintage movies Cinderella, Sleeping Beauty, and Snow White and the Seven Dwarfs, those in subsequent films are lucky to get even one-third of the dialogue.
